Chemical reaction schemes are typically simplified by considering the contr
olling steps of the process, the 'fast' reactions being taken into account
by quasi-equilibrium assumptions. Traditionally, intuitive reasoning is emp
loyed to arrive at the simplified system. This may, however, be cumbersome
and sometimes misleading. In this paper a systematic approach is presented
that guarantees that the simplified model coincides with the asymptotics of
